What is Gentian Liqueur?

Gentian is a mountain plant whose roots have been used for centuries for their digestive properties and intense flavor. Its liqueur, prized by lovers of bitter spirits, offers a unique alternative to classic aperitifs.

How to drink gentian liqueur?

Gentian liqueur can be enjoyed chilled, neat or over ice, as an aperitif or digestif. Its natural bitterness also makes it an excellent base for refreshing cocktails: topped up with tonic water, dry white wine, or sparkling water, it reveals all its complexity. When to harvest gentian

Yellow gentian (Gentiana lutea) is generally harvested between late spring and early autumn, depending on altitude. Its roots, rich in bitter ingredients, are used in liqueur. The plant must be at least 5 to 10 years old for its roots to be sufficiently developed. Gentian: where to find it?

Gentian grows naturally at high altitudes, primarily in European mountain ranges such as the Massif Central, the Alps, and the Pyrenees. It thrives in high-altitude meadows between 800 and 2,000 meters.
